A guide to uninstall KKBOX from your PC

This info is about KKBOX for Windows. Below you can find details on how to uninstall it from your computer. It is developed by KKBOX Taiwan Co., Ltd.. Take a look here where you can get more info on KKBOX Taiwan Co., Ltd.. Further information about KKBOX can be found at . The application is frequently located in the C:\Program Files (x86)\KKBOX directory (same installation drive as Windows). You can remove KKBOX by clicking on the Start menu of Windows and pasting the command line C:\Program Files (x86)\KKBOX\uninst.exe. Note that you might get a notification for administrator rights. KKBOX.exe is the programs's main file and it takes close to 15.79 MB (16554584 bytes) on disk.

KKBOX contains of the executables below. They occupy 15.85 MB (16622321 bytes) on disk.




  • KKBOX.exe (15.79 MB)
  • uninst.exe (66.15 KB)


The information on this page is only about version 7.3.20 of KKBOX. You can find below info on other application versions of KKBOX:
